Fraud Protection
Cayman National Fraud Unit
- The Fraud Unit in the Card Services Department monitors
cardholder's spending patterns and may contact cardholder's to verify
if a transaction is legitimate for those that appear unusual or
suspicious.
- When the fraud officers have exhausted their resources to make contact, a
temporary block is placed on the card for your protection until you can be reached.
- We recommend that if you are traveling or will be making purchases outside of
your normal spending pattern, contact a Fraud Officer or our Customer Support
Department ahead of time to notify us of your plans.

- In addition to our account monitoring effects, we
encourage you to monitor your accounts online on a regular basis, keep
contact information current, keep items with personal information in a safe place, and
never provide bank account or credit card details to anyone who contacts you by phone
or email.
